Here is a list of some events happened on January 1.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1994 | The North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A) comes into effect. |
| 1995 | The World Trade Organization comes into being. |
| 1958 | The European Economic Community is established. |
| 1527 | Croatian nobles elect Ferdinand I, Archduke of Austria as King of Croatia in the 1527 election in Cetin. |
| 1772 | The first traveler's cheques, which could be used in 90 European cities, are issued by the London Credit Exchange Company. |
| 1914 | The SPT Airboat Line becomes the world's first scheduled airline to use a winged aircraft. |
| 1999 | Euro currency is introduced in 11 member nations of the European Union (with the exception of the United Kingdom, Denmark, Greece and Sweden; Greece adopts the euro two years later). |
| 1861 | Liberal forces supporting Benito Juárez enter Mexico City. |
| 1962 | Western Samoa achieves independence from New Zealand; its name is changed to the Independent State of Western Samoa. |
| 1892 | Ellis Island begins processing immigrants into the United States. |
